General Motors is celebrating the Chevrolet Centennial this year – and
treating us to some nice historical footage, like this three-minute video
celebrating the Bowtie brand’s motorsports heritage. While Chevy’s racing
involvement in recent years has been mostly focused on NASCAR and its Corvette
Le Mans program, the marque enjoys a wealth of history in almost every racing
series.
Among the treats in this promotional piece are a few seconds of Bruce Larson’s
USA-1 Camaro Funny Car and Jim Hall’s famous Chaparral 2 sports car, vintage
NASCAR action from the era in which the term “stock car” still meant
something, and there’s a mention of Juan Manuel Fangio’s stint as a Chevy
driver in 1940. Of course, patron saint of Chevy Racing, Dale Earnhardt makes
an appearance, as well.
Although the video teases us with some cool old footage, it also relies on
still photography and the “Ken Burns effect” – a lot. It would be great to see
some more racing clips and less static shots of cars like the 1978
Indianapolis 500 Corvette Pace Car. In fact, we’d love to see GM commission a
